For warlocks, they are the class with the lowest armor score in the game, and can't top a Mage on the DPS scale if we tried. It takes more skill than you think to be a successful warlock in PvP or in PVE.
I'm sorry, but the primary form of armor you have until level 70 was Demon Armor, which increased your armor, and made you regen even while in combat, while the primarily used Mage Armor provided 0 armor, 15 resist to all schools of Magic, and 30% mana regen.

Additionally, from what I've seen, most Warlocks tend to have higher armor than Mages due to class-specific gear, and all Warlock-specific gear has much much higher +sta.

Lastly, your damage is going to vary depending on your spec. If you're still affliction, I wouldn't expect to be top on the damage charts, however if you have an Imp Scorch Mage combined with Destro-spec, you should be a good 4% or higher on the total damage done charts if you both are comparatively-geared.
